GREENSAW is seeking a CONSTRUCTION ADMINISTRATOR to assist Project Managers in everyday administration of projects and to oversee internal labor scheduling on projects. This job requires a good sense of detail & organization.
RESPONSIBILITIES:
- Oversee and supervise the preparation, review, and administration of prime contracts and subcontracts relating to construction projects.
- Proactively track construction project progress from project inception through final inspection; providing early identification of non-compliance issues (e.g., budget overruns, timeline slippage, etc.)
- Draft and prepare agreements (Subcontracts / Amendments / Change Orders) and analyze and interpret documents to determine contractual rights and obligations.
- Obtain estimates from Subcontractors and collaborate on the solicitation of bids.
- Ensure all on-going project activities are provided with up-to-date construction plans and specifications and, where necessary, ensure awareness / compliance with approved plan changes.
- Observe construction for conformity with the design plans and specifications.
- Assist Project Managers in preparation of construction schedules.
- Function as one of the primary contacts and subject matter experts on construction administrative activities. Conduct construction meetings with clients and subcontractors.
- Other administrative tasks as requested, including drafting correspondence and maintaining files
QUALIFICATIONS:
- Experience in construction management, which must have included managing project schedules and budgets, writing construction contracts, bidding projects, negotiating change orders, and ensuring contract compliance for projects.
- Experience reviewing scope comparisons, analyzing, assessing terms and conditions, and preparing counter-offer recommendations for construction bids.
- Experience in reading, navigating, and interpreting architectural drawings and specifications.
- Experience in developing construction schedules.
- Experience negotiating with outside vendors, including negotiating contracts, prices, resolving service issues and reconciling differences.
